The metal inner windshield corner molding has a large hole (arrow) which lines up with a screw hole in the plastic pillar post molding (which fits over the corner piece). There is no corresponding hole in the pillar post itself. Anyone know how this works?

The screw goes through the A pillar cover and through the hole on the reveal and picks up this clip on the side of the A pillar. Clip similar to what is used for windshield upper reveal on hardtops and coupes.
